The development of a nodule at the injection site is a known but rare adverse event following immunisation (AEFI). Nodules are defined as the presence of a palpable, firm, discrete or well-demarcated soft tissue lump at the site of …

WebbFeline injection site sarcomas (FISSs) are malignant tumors of mesenchymal (connective tissue) origin. Conflicting epidemiologic data indicate FISSs develop as infrequently as less than 1 case per 10 000 vaccinated cats or as often as 1 in 1000 vaccinated cats. 1,2 Rabies and feline leukemia virus (FeLV) vaccines are known inciting causes of FISSs. 3 … WebbThe 81-page document, prepared by Fenway Health, recommends the city begin with a large trailer, outfitted as a clinic, stationed in a city-owned parking lot. Webb11 feb. 2024 · A “three, two, one” protocol has been suggested to monitor for post-vaccination masses: any mass at the site of injection three months or more following vaccination, more than 2cm in diameter, or that increases in size one month after vaccination should be investigated and surgical excision of the mass is warranted. …
